Description
The National Institute of Mental Health (NIMH) intends to negotiate and award a purchase order without providing for full and open competition to Neu-Ion, Inc. The purpose of this acquisition is to furnish and install a replacement pretreatment system for the Building 49 reverse osmosis (RO) water system, including a twin parallel multimedia filter system, twin carbon filter system, and twin alternating softener system. The Building 49 RO water system serves the Central Animal Facility (CAF) and multi-IC laboratories, and the pretreatment system is required to remove contaminants, reduce fouling and scaling, and protect the RO membranes to ensure continued system efficiency and longevity.
